Overview

Foothill High is a public high serving grades 9–12 in Bakersfield, California. The school enrolls 2,043 students. It is part of the Kern High district.

Equity & Title I

In the United States, Free/Reduced Lunch (FRL) eligibility is the primary federal proxy for student poverty. Schools with 40% or more FRL-eligible students typically qualify for Title I school-wide programs.
